Unbelievable True Stories of Cyber Mayhem Inside History’s Greatest Cyberattacks, you’ll uncover real-life hacking incidents that changed the world. From high-stakes espionage to billion-dollar heists, these stories reveal the shocking ways cybercriminals and nation-states have exploited technology. Colonial Pipeline Ransomware Attack – A single hack shuts down the largest fuel supplier in the U.S., causing nationwide panic. The Bangladesh Bank Heist – Criminals exploit the SWIFT banking system to steal $81 million—and almost got away with $1 billion. The Shadow Brokers Leak – A shadow steals and leaks the NSA’s most powerful cyberweapons, setting off a global hacking arms race. Stuxnet: The First Digital Weapon – A computer virus designed like a missile takes down Iran’s nuclear program without firing a shot. Bezos’ Phone Hack – The richest man in the world, Amazon’s Jeff Bezos, is hacked, and the fallout exposes an international scandal. WannaCry & NotPetya – A stolen NSA exploit is turned into a cyber weapon, spreading across the world and causing billions in damages. Ashley Madison Data Breach – A hacker group exposes millions of cheating spouses, destroying lives and revealing shocking secrets. Operation Glowing Symphony – The U.S. military hacks ISIS, dismantling its online propaganda machine. Casino Jackpot Hackers – Two clever friends beat Las Vegas slot machines and walk away with millions before the casinos fight back. SolarWinds: The Most Widespread Cyberattack in History – Russian hackers breach U.S. government agencies and Fortune 500 companies by exploiting a trusted software update. GPS Spoofing: How Iran Stole a U.S. Spy Drone – Iranian hackers trick a stealth drone into landing safely in enemy territory, handing them classified U.S. technology. Phone-Tapping Nuclear Submarines – A secret U.S. submarine taps into Russia’s undersea military cables, uncovering intelligence in one of the most daring digital espionage operations ever.
